Independent Testing Confirms Comverse Mobile Internet Performance Leadership


WAKEFIELD, Mass., Jan 09, 2013 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E via COMTEX) -- Comverse Data Management and Monetization (DMM) Policy Manager emerged from independent testing with industry-leading performance statistics, underscoring its ability to scale to support the mushrooming data volumes that carriers face, reported Comverse, Inc. (Nasdaq:CNSI), the global leader in business enablement through BSS, mobile Internet, value-added and managed services.



Conducted by the European Advanced Networking Test Center (EANTC), internationally renowned for objectivity, neutrality and accuracy, the testing examined Comverse DMM Policy Manager performance and scalability over a variety of 3GPP standard interfaces.

Test Highlights Test results indicate that the DMM Policy Manager is distinguished by having the highest independently proven transactions per second (TPS) figures in the industry per single chassis: -- Verified 31.5 million simultaneously active subscribers in a single DMM Policy Manager chassis -- Measured more than 200,000 transactions per second in a single DMM Policy Manager chassis in all scenarios, including advanced LTE use case -- Support of 15,000 TPS per blade with linear scalability -- Interface Diversity: Supporting Gx, Rx, and the newly released 3GPP Release 11 Sy for OCS-PCRF integration Exceptional Performance Supports Foreseeable Requirements, LTE, M2M "In light of the exponential increases in data usage, the move to tiered data plans for smart monetization and the growing number of Long-Term Evolution (LTE) deployments, a highly scalable and interoperable Policy Charging and Rules (PCRF) function is critical," said Carsten Rossenhoevel, Managing Director at EANTC. "Our test results confirm that the Comverse DMM Policy Manager's performance values exceed current and upcoming requirements of mobile service providers. The DMM Policy Manager has demonstrated impressive scalability to grow alongside any successful network, making it suitable to support advanced LTE and machine-to-machine (M2M) scenarios." About EANTC The European Advanced Networking Test Center (EANTC) is one of the leading vendor-neutral telecommunication consultancy and test facilities worldwide. EANTC's customers are network equipment manufacturers, service providers and enterprises. Primary business areas include interoperability, conformance, and performance testing for Carrier Ethernet, IP/MPLS, Mobile backhaul and core networks, Triple Play and cloud data center technologies and applications.
